How much do fulltime creative project manager j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 17, 2026, the average yearly pay for fulltime creative project manager in Rochester, MN is $98,232.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$83,400.00 and $112,800.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Fulltime Creative Project Manager vs Creative Producer?

AspectFulltime Creative Project ManagerCreative Producer
CredentialsProject management certifications, relevant design or marketing experienceCreative industry experience, often with production or media background
Work EnvironmentOffice, agency, or corporate settings managing projectsProduction sites, studios, or media environments overseeing creative outputs
Employer & Industry UsageAdvertising agencies, marketing firms, corporate teamsMedia companies, production houses, advertising agencies

Fulltime Creative Project Managers focus on planning, executing, and delivering creative projects on time and within budget, often coordinating teams and resources. Creative Producers handle the creative process, managing production workflows, and ensuring the final product aligns with client or project goals. While both roles require industry knowledge and project coordination skills, the Project Manager emphasizes management and logistics, whereas the Producer emphasizes creative oversight and production execution.

Job description

Job Description:
As a Project Executive, you will provide high level project oversight, leadership to project management team, setting expectations & objectives as well as all financial aspects of assigned area/division. This individual is responsible for overseeing all financial aspects, business development, planning and talent development for team members.
Manage Safety Compliance and foster a culture of safety:
  • Perform site walkthroughs and inspections
  • Assure site safety compliance by ensuring all safety requirements are being performed - this includes site specific safety plans, audits, tool box talks, pre-task planning and being proficient in using Industry Safe

Operations Management:
  • Ensure project teams manage all project documentation, preplanning, project hand-offs, prefab, job set-up, policies, procedures, schedules, resources, etc.
  • Monitor and oversee project financial performance. Coach and advise PMs in preparation for monthly PM reviews. Attend PM reviews
  • Monitor, encourage and promote safety on projects
  • Improve the success of negotiating changes on a given project by coaching, advising and leading team members through the process. Attend negotiations as needed
  • Oversee and/or perform pre-construction activities

Leadership:
  • Coach, mentor and develop team members
  • Work collaboratively with other leaders to plan for workforce needs to support and drive projects
  • Coach and manage performance and goals for team. Motivate and inspire team to achieve and surpass goals
  • Build and cultivate an effective team to support and drive business goals/objectives
  • Recruit and interview candidates to build an effective team

Strategic Planning:
  • Develop, lead and support strategic initiatives for the group, division and/or company
  • Actively participate in various corporate strategic initiatives as assigned

Estimation:
  • Oversee and/or perform estimation process, ensuring team coordinates with suppliers, vendors and subcontractors to estimate projects
  • Oversee and/or prepare estimates utilizing estimating software
  • Oversee and/or attend pre-bid, page turn, project turnover and preplanning meetings as required
  • Oversee and/or assist/prepare scope/proposal letter

Financial Management:
  • Oversee and ensure all projects are meeting financial objectives, are tracked, monitored and reported on a regular basis. This includes and is not limited to:
    • Labor Productivity
    • Weekly PDCA
    • Risk Management
    • Communications
    • Purchasing
    • Billings
    • Collection Issues
    • PM Reviews

Develop, Build & Maintain relationships:
  • Develop and maintain relationships with key clients. (Owners and General Contractors)
  • Actively participate in industry associations and networking events

Manage Sales Process:
  • Plan, track and manage sales funnel along with resources needed to support it
  • As required, establish industry relationships to ensure project sales growth in the future
  • Attend customer outings and events
  • Communicate company interest and capabilities to potential customers for future projects and/or change orders
  • Provide leadership and oversight for all team proposals, including but not limited to estimating and proposal writing
  • Drive division sales goals. Oversee management of key accounts accordingly

What we're looking for in you
  • Associate's degree in a technical field or journeyman-level certification required
  • Bachelor's degree in technical or construction management preferred
  • 10+ years of advanced knowledge and proficiency of building & construction industry
  • 10+ years of Construction Project Management experience
  • Strong understanding of mechanical systems
  • Ability to read and comprehend construction documents
  • Use/knowledge of Harris' accounting/project & labor management software
  • Experience with project management software (e.g. MS Project, MS SharePoint, ProCor, etc.)
  • Proficient with computer aided design software
  • Proficient in MS Office Suite
  • Knowledge of design techniques, tools and principles
